Not a UPS really but a high power, stepped square wave mains inverter from 12V. It was blow up when I got hold of it it. I now have it working with new output high voltage MOSFETS.
Having made this sort of thing before with heavy conventional transformer etc., I was amassed at this modern HF version, just how small & light weight it is.

DESCRIPTION
It has 5 pot core HF pulse width inverters with 2 TIP MOSFETS each handling 200W. The 5 floating secondaries are connected in series to feed a fast high voltage bridge rectifier to a HF choke, into large 400V smoothing cap.

The pulse width feedback controls that voltage to 340V. This powers 2 high voltage MOSFET amps (blown up) that switch the L & N to +340V for 2/3 for the time giving the 340V peak & 230V RMS 50Hz stepped waveform output.

The control for this lot is not simple, there is monitoring of temperature, output current, supply Volts, etc. So working without the diagram is not easy. Still I have it going now, & done some worth while modifications....
PULSE CURRENT
If a capacitive load from say a good mains filter is put across the output, then the high voltage Power MOFETs can easily be blown up again, as very high pulse edge currents can flow.

WARNING
Devices that use the reactance of mains caps to drop the mains voltage can be destroyed on this waveform. e.g. a true RMS digital meter! As the pulse edge puts 100x the voltage into the current limiting R or the circuit...
